SAN FRANCISCO — Findem, the only AI talent acquisition and management solution powered by unique 3D data, has launched the next generation of its Talent CRM with new features that help recruiters keep top candidates warm and move faster when hiring needs ramp up

AUSTIN, Texas —- Flo Recruit, an ATS for legal talent recruitng, announced that it has closed a Series A round led by LiveOak Ventures and Moneta Ventures with participation from The LegalTech Fund, Y Combinator, and otherd. Flo Recruit intends to use the funds to expand its career services solutions for law schools and talent solutions for law firm entry-level, lateral associate, and partner hiring.

UTAH — Awardco announced today a $165 million Series B round of funding with a valuation that eclipses $1 billion, further solidifying its leadership and innovation in the employee rewards and recognition space.

Los Angeles, CA – Criteria Corp, a leader in talent solutions, today announced the launch of Interview Intelligence (IIQ), a suite of AI-powered interview features that elevate Criteria’s Structured Interviewing platform. This groundbreaking advancement marks a major leap forward in hiring efficiency, predictive power, and scientific rigor.

Cangrade today announced the launch of Jules interview practice tool, designed to help jobseekers refine their interview skills through personalized, on-demand mock interview sessions. Building on the success of Jules for self-discovery, this new capability simulates real interview scenarios by analyzing a user’s job description and resume to generate tailored behavioral and soft skill questions dynamically.
